Itinerary:

Join me Sunday morning for a long hike at Kennesaw Mountain National Park.

You need to have recent AOC D4 or D5 hiking experience! We will start at the Visitor's Center

Please note that the group will spread out depending on the experience level and the speed of the individual hiker. This hike is designed so you can walk with the group or by yourself. If you sign up, you should be comfortable to hike at a moderate pace (2.5 - 2.7 mph) in order to complete the hike within the time specified.

We will start at the Visitor's Center and hike across Big and Little Kennesaw Mountains down to Burnt Hickory Road (3 miles). There, we turn around and go back the same way we came. When you are back at the Visitor's Center (6 miles), you may take a short rest before heading back up Big Kennesaw Mountain and over Little Kennesaw mountain - all the way to the 2 mile marker (8 miles). That is the point where you can turn around and return to the Visitor's Center again by going back over Big Kennesaw Mountain one last time (10 miles).

Please be aware that this hike has over 3,000 ft elevation gain. So, please be sure that you are fit enough for this hike. However, if during the hike you feel you cannot complete the total 10 miles, you are welcome to turn around and return to the visitor's center. Just let me know. In order to get credit for the hike, however, you will have to hike all of the 10 miles!

Please arrive with enough time to account for possibly having to park at the overflow parking lot or get your parking pass. It takes about 10-12 minutes to walk from the big parking lot to the visitor's center. We will start the hike on time.

How to Get There:
Event Directions:

Directions and Parking:

1) I-75 North to exit 267B Hwy 5 Canton Road Connector

2) If you are not heading west after getting off of the Interstate you are going the wrong way. You should be heading towards US 41 and downtown Marietta after getting off of I-75 onto the Canton Road Connector and see Kennesaw Mountain on your right.

3) You will be tempted to take the first exit off of the Canton Road Connector which is US 41, but do not take it. Proceed over US 41 on a bridge staying on the Canton Road Connector.

4) After crossing US 41 take a right at the first redlight which is Church Street Extension.

5) You should cross railroad tracks soon.

6) Take a left onto Old 41 at the second redlight. If you get to US 41 again, you have missed the turn onto Old 41 so turn around.

7) Stay on Old US 41 until you pass in front of the mountain and park on the right-hand side of the road (or in the new parking lot on the left) after passing the redlight for Stilesboro Road.

FYI: The new parking lot - approximately 270 spaces, is now open but parking on Old Highway 41 is not yet closed. Park by Old Highway 41 or in this new parking lot - whichever you feel more comfortable with.

8) Last resort / panic mode / all available parking spaces have been taken: When this happens, here is where to park - Turn around and head back in front of the mountain on Old 41. Take the first left which is White Circle Road. Take the first right which is White Road Court. Park on the side of the road.


Notes:

There is a $5.00 parking fee

Please make sure that you have ample time to walk from the overflow parking lot to the visitor's center (8 min) in order to be on time for the hike. We will not wait for latecomers, but call me in case you encounter troubles finding a parking spot.

Bathroom facilities are available at the visitor's center which opens the outer doors at 7:30
